Mission Formats:

There is two mission formats and one weekend format conducted by Good News Ministries.

"Dare to Live the Gospel" - A Parish Mission


The “Dare to Live the Gospel” mission is the primary and most fundamental mission given by Good News Ministries. It has at its core the concepts of CONVERSION, SPITIRUALITY, and RELATIONSHIP. The heart of the mission is founded in the Sermon on the Mount where Jesus clearly calls each and everyone us to live the life of “light” and “salt”.   It is based upon the "Be-attitudinal" proclamations of Jesus as the basis for living out His teachings in the Sermon on the Mount.
The need of conversion is not based in the need of change of one religion to her but in the deep understanding that God has more to offer. In order to enter into this “more” it is necessary to “change” or “convert” from the ways of the world to the way of the Spirit. Our spirituality in turn brings us to the depths of the ultimate journey… a deeper relationship with the God of the Universe.
Relationship is everything! There is nothing more important than relationship. The deepest and most profound relationship with God is found only through spiritual conversion.
The mission starts on Sunday evening and ends on Wednesday evening. Morning sessions can be done in addition to the evening sessions. The morning sessions are entirely different from the evening sessions.

"Living in the Kingdom" - A Parish Mission

The “Living in the Kingdom” mission is conducted usually as the follow up mission to the “Dare to Live the Gospel” mission. The focus is directed to the two solutions we believe will bring renewal to each person individually and in turn to the Church. These two solutions are the HOLY SPIRIT and understanding life in COMMUNITY. This is lived out first in our own personal families and then in the larger, Church family. Yielding to the direction of the Holy Spirit in our personal lives as well as in our spiritual lives IS the definitive solution to bringing healing and wholeness to our families and to the Church family.
The format for this mission is the same as for the “Dare to Live the Gospel” mission. The mission starts on Sunday evening and ends on Wednesday evening. Morning sessions can be done for this mission also. The morning sessions are entirely different than the evening sessions.

"Stewardship" -  A Parish Seminar


One of the major challenges facing the Church today revolves around the issue of Stewardship.  As often as it spoken of in the Church, there still remains the problem of implementation.  The problem is the "how to's."  This weekend seminar develops very spicifically the blue print for transforming a church into a church community whose mindset or vision is based in the spirituality of true stewardship.  Time, talent, and treasure are understood in the context of witness, blessing, and generosity.

This Seminar is centered in Church teachings, spiritually based, and biblically oriented.
